5 FAQs About Shipping from China to Netherlands Customs
1. What documents are needed for customs clearance in the Netherlands?
- Commercial invoice (with HS codes, product value, and origin).
- Packing list (detailed cargo description and weight).
- Bill of Lading/Air Waybill.
- CE certification (for regulated products like electronics).

3. What are the costs involved in customs clearance?
- VAT: 21% of the product value + shipping costs.
- Import duties: 0–17% (depends on HS code).
- Storage fees: €50–€150/day if clearance is delayed.

Customs Clearance Process: Step-by-Step Overview
Step | Description | Avg. Time |
---|---|---|
Document Preparation | Submit invoices, packing lists, and certificates. | 1–3 days |
Customs Declaration | Declare goods and pay VAT/duties via Dutch Customs (Douane). | 1–2 days |
Inspection (if needed) | Physical or document check by authorities. | 1–5 days |
Release & Delivery | Goods cleared and dispatched to final destination. | 1–2 days |
Data based on 2024 EU import regulations. Delays occur if paperwork is incomplete.
